Kalhel (550) is a village located in the Churah Tehsil of Chamba district of Himachal Pradesh. The village falls in Koti block and comes under Kalhel Gram Panchayat. It belongs to Kangra parliament constituency and Churah assembly constituency.
As on May 2024, the current population of Kalhel (550) is 283 out of which 139 are males and rest 144 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 1036 females per 1000 males. There are around 42 teenagers in Kalhel (550). It has literacy rate of 64% which means around 181 persons can read and write. Total 156 people belonging to scheduled caste and 5 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 53 households in Kalhel (550), which means every family has 5 members on average. The village has working population of 207. The pincode of Kalhel (550) is 176319 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
